Olivero chalks up another award
12/15/2003 12:00:00 AM | Men's Basketball
Jose Olivero has been named the Patriot League Freshman of the Week for the second consecutive week, it was announced on Monday. Olivero scored 23 points in the Mountain Hawks lone game last week, including the game-winning three-pointer with seven seconds remaining as Lehigh defeated Columbia 60-57. Olivero scored ten consecutive points at one juncture of the second half to bring the Mountain Hawks back from an eleven point deficit and lead them to victory.
On the season, Olivero is now averaging 13.0 points on the season, which leads the team, and is shooting a team-leading 89% (23-26) from the foul stripe. He has led the team in scoring the past four games, coming into Wednesday night’s game versus Del Val. Jose is the first Mountain Hawks to receive a Patriot League award this season.
